151127

151,127 is an odd composite number composed of two pr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 151127 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 2 prime factors (large circles) and 4 divisors.

151127 is an odd composite number. It is composed of two dist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of four divisors.

Prime factorization of 151127:

79 × 1913

Factors of 151127

  • Number of distinct prime factors ω(n): 2
  • Total number of prime factors Ω(n): 2
  • Sum of prime factors: 1992

Divisors of 151127

  • Number of divisors d(n): 4
  • Complete list of divisors:
  • Sum of all divisors σ(n): 153120
  •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 1993
  • 151127 is a deficient number, because the sum of its proper divisors (1993) is less than itself. Its deficiency is 149134
